4300 Sonoma Blvd, Vallejo, CA 94589 (Map)
(707) 648-0315
2118 1st St, Livermore, CA 94550 (Map)
(925) 447-5535
3278 Adeline St, Berkeley, CA 94703 (Map)
(510) 594-9302
2028 Lewelling Blvd, San Leandro, CA 94579 (Map)
(510) 895-2792
1832 Euclid Ave, Berkeley, CA 94709 (Map)
(510) 845-9090
+1 510.845.9091
7163 Rich Ave, Newark, CA 94560 (Map)
(510) 792-2600
2190 N Texas St, Fairfield, CA 94533 (Map)
(707) 422-4403
415 Main St, Suisun City, CA 94585 (Map)
(707) 429-5871
3335 Sonoma Blvd, Vallejo, CA 94590 (Map)
(707) 644-4622
458 E 14th St, San Leandro, CA 94577 (Map)
(510) 777-0407
2975 College Ave, Berkeley, CA 94705 (Map)
(510) 704-1789
41240 Fremont Blvd, Fremont, CA 94538 (Map)
(510) 657-8602
320 A St, Hayward, CA 94541 (Map)
(510) 538-8481
19950 Hesperian Blvd, Hayward, CA 94541 (Map)
(510) 784-2302
3100 Main St, Oakley, CA 94561 (Map)
(925) 625-1515
5362 College Ave, Oakland, CA 94618 (Map)
(510) 420-8822
1060 Newpark Mall, Newark, CA 94560 (Map)
(510) 713-8998
325 23rd St, Richmond, CA 94804 (Map)
(510) 232-6955
1462 High St, Oakland, CA 94601 (Map)
(510) 532-2337